197. Prolonged Grief Disorder 06.03.2023 22:50
Grief is not a disorder, we were built to grieve. However, if at a certain point, it is persistently interfering with the quality of your life, you might be experiencing prolonged grief disorder. Hear what prolonged grief disorder entails so you can understand if this describes your experience and identify the support you need.
